Ted Vasin

Gallery Affiliations: 101 Exhibit

Region: Pacific Coast

Website: http://tedvasin.com

City / State: San Francisco, CA

Okay, I admit it. I enjoy my stay in America. Basically, as an artist I can say whatever the fuck I want. This is the letter home. This is the way I do it. I send messages, you receive them.